I own a Korg M50 since June 2010.
Everything was right, but in November 2012 the workstation started to have some volume problems. I send it to repair, but incredibly after some days they called me and told me that everything was all right and that they didn't find any problem with the M50.
And so again everything went good until a couple of weeks ago: the problem returned, and everything was worse than before. Today I was playing with my friend and suddenly the M50 didn't sound anymore...oh, before this some keys I pressed didn't sound like the note i was pressing (example: I pressed C3 and the M50 played F#4 and so on), lots of IFX were applied random and without a meaning and most sounds were distorted.
After two hours everything seems to be returned normal, but I still have volume problems and this is not the first time I get this stuff.
What should I do? Please Help me!!

Hi, my point of view about the issues are maybe due overheating of the main processor (MX-1) and Big Endian (PCM-DSP effects chip). The Pa500 use the same architecture and similar OS as the M50. On my arranger I decided to cool down the chips to avoid malfunctioning issues due overheating. Modern devices use the ball grid array case (small contact pins below the ICs) to transfer the silicon heat to the PCB circuit board. Unfortunately heat produce mechanical forces due expansion/contraction of the pins and the PCB solder mask (also heat can degrade the logic inside the chips) leading to random issues.
Overheating on digital devices are the root causes about random issues and boards RIP. You can try to re install the OS firmware to discard corrupted data on the flash EEPROM.
My advice is to ask for technical support on a music store or Korg official services if the issue remains. Regards.
